>>Problem: Vulnerabilities in /usr/vmsys/bin/chkperm
>>Platform: Solaris 2.4, 2.5, 2.5.1, other System V derived
>>          systems with the FACE package installed
>
>Of interest to the full disclosure argument, I reported this to Sun
>more than a year ago.


Teh bug is actually fixed in 2.5 and 2.5.1, though they seem to have
broken the program in the process.  [ a line of code was dropped
inadvertedly ]

I don't know why this was never made into a patch.

(And the fact that the program is now broken and nobody reported a bug on it,
makes me wonder ....)
